Farias v. Shell Pipeline Company
Plaintiff: Mary Lou Farias
Defendant: Shell Pipeline Company
Case Number: 1:2019at00208
Filed: March 21, 2019
Court: US District Court for the Eastern District of California
Nature of Suit: Civil Rights: Jobs
Cause of Action: 28 U.S.C. ยง 1332
Jury Demanded By: Plaintiff
Docket Report

This docket was last retrieved on March 21, 2019. A more recent docket listing may be available from PACER.

Date Filed Document Text
March 21, 2019 Filing 3 CERTIFICATE of SERVICE by Shell Pipeline Company. (Chun, Brian)
March 21, 2019 Filing 2 CORPORATE DISCLOSURE STATEMENT by Defendant Shell Pipeline Company. (Chun, Brian)
March 21, 2019 Filing 1 NOTICE of REMOVAL from Fresno County Superior Court, case number 19CECG00527 by Shell Pipeline Company. (Filing fee $ 400, receipt number 0972-8172588) (Attachments: #1 Civil Cover Sheet)(Chun, Brian)
